Stamford University Bangladesh recently hosted a remarkable and distinctive event titled the ‘Robotics Project Showcase’ at its Siddheswari campus. This innovative program was designed to foster hands-on learning and encourage the spirit of technological innovation among students, aiming to inspire the next generation of engineers, developers, and inventors.
The event was thoughtfully organized by the university’s Robotics Club, a student-led initiative dedicated to advancing knowledge and practical skills in robotics and automation. The program attracted distinguished guests, including Dr. Farhana Feroz, the esteemed Chairperson of the Board of Trustees of Stamford University Bangladesh, who expressed strong support for nurturing technological education. The university’s Registrar was also in attendance, along with the department heads of Computer Science and Engineering and Electrical and Electronic Engineering, who are pivotal in shaping the university’s STEM curriculum. Raihan Uddin Ahmed, the convener of the Robotics Club, played a key role in coordinating the event and ensuring its success.
During the showcase, five exhibition stalls displayed an impressive range of robotics projects. These included contributions from four leading robotics companies in Bangladesh: ZerOne, DIP Foundation, Ulterior, and Robo Tech Valley. Each company presented cutting-edge technologies and innovative solutions that reflect Bangladesh’s growing expertise in the field of robotics. Additionally, the Stamford University Robotics Club (SURC) curated its own dedicated stall, where students demonstrated their projects and shared their learning experiences.
The participants passionately presented their groundbreaking projects, engaging with visiting students and faculty members. Visitors showed enthusiastic interest, actively exploring the exhibits and asking insightful questions. At the university’s own stall, the Stamford Robotics Club provided detailed demonstrations of fundamental robotics principles. They showcased various projects involving essential components such as microcontrollers, sensors, and sophisticated weight distribution mechanisms. These exhibits aimed to demystify the complex field of robotics, making it more accessible and comprehensible for students. The club members meticulously explained their work, displaying deep knowledge, enthusiasm, and technical skill, which reflected their dedication to robotics education.
